Fidelity Q3 Signal Report: The net unrealized gains and losses of BTC, ETH, and SOL are all at historical lows, with multiple indicators approaching the capitulation zone

2026-07-29 00:28:28
Collection

According to the Q3 2026 signal report released by Fidelity Digital Assets, the prices of BTC, ETH, and SOL are generally at historical lows, with multiple indicators close to the capitulation zone. Fidelity believes that the current valuation levels may correspond to attractive long-term entry conditions.

As of the end of Q2, the weighted net unrealized profit and loss (NUPL) was -0.01, with BTC being the only asset with a positive unrealized profit, approximately 10% above its cost basis, with an unrealized profit of about $108 billion, while ETH and SOL were approximately 30% and 41% below their cost bases, with unrealized losses of about $87 billion and $29 billion, respectively. BTC's market share rose to 68% quarter-over-quarter.

The report states that, based on historical backtesting, the current NUPL readings for the three correspond to one-year median returns of 53%, 70%, and 542%, respectively, but the reliability of the samples decreases sequentially. The NUPL reading for SOL has only occurred 21 times in history, concentrated at the end of 2025, which has limited statistical significance.

On the fundamental side, the value of stablecoin transfers for both ETH and SOL has reached new highs, exceeding $20 trillion and $2.6 trillion, respectively, over the past 12 months, but network fee revenue continues to decline.

Additionally, the report attributes the 22% decline in BTC hash rate from its peak to miners shifting their computing power towards AI and high-performance computing, as AI contract revenues are more stable due to the depressed coin prices.
